#d4abb6 color RGB value is (212,171,182). #d4abb6 color name is Custom Color color.

#d4abb6 hex color red value is 212, green value is 171 and the blue value of its RGB is 182. Cylindrical-coordinate representations (also known as HSL) of color #d4abb6 hue: 0.96, saturation: 0.32 and the lightness value of d4abb6 is 0.75.

The process color (four color CMYK) of #d4abb6 color hex is 0.00, 0.19, 0.14, 0.17. Web safe color of #d4abb6 is #cc99cc. Color #d4abb6 contains mainly PINK color.

About #D4ABB6 Custom Color

#D4ABB6 (Custom Color) is a pink-based color with RGB values of 212, 171, 182. This color belongs to the pink color family and can be used in various design applications including web design, graphic design, interior design, and branding projects.

When working with #d4abb6, designers often pair it with complementary colors to create visual contrast, or use analogous colors for a more harmonious palette. The shades (darker versions) and tints (lighter versions) shown above provide a monochromatic color scheme that works well for creating depth and hierarchy in designs.

For web development, #d4abb6 can be implemented using various CSS color formats including hexadecimal (#d4abb6), RGB (rgb(212, 171, 182)), HSL (hsl(344, 32%, 75%)), or CMYK for print projects. The web-safe equivalent of this color is #cc99cc, which ensures consistent display across older browsers and devices.
